Emergency Services Levy Determination 2021-22 — $391,316,000
Determines the emergency services levy payable for the levy year 2021-22 to be $391,316,000.

Notice Text
Pursuant to section 36g(3) of the fire and emergency services act 1998 (the act), the minister is to determine the emergency services levy (esl) that is payable for the next levy year on all land that is located in an esl area. Your approval is sought for a determination that the emergency services levy payable for the levy year 2021-22 is $391,316,000. Pursuant to section 36g(3) of the act, that figure has been identified by reference to the following relevant matters— • advice received from the under treasurer on 25 may 2021 confirmed that— o dfes’ esl funding requirement for 2021-22 will be $391.316 million; and o for the 2021-22 levy year, all expenditure that is approved for dfes and in excess of the $391.316 million esl funding requirement will be met through other funding sources.
